Crime overview

Cedarwood Glade area has the 6th lowest crime rate of 36 local areas in Hemlington , and the 57th lowest crime rate of 457 local areas in Middlesbrough .

This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Cedarwood Glade (TS8 9DJ) in the last 12 months was 32.6 per 1,000 residents and was 84.6% lower than the Hemlington average (211.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 2 offences recorded. The least common crime was Violence and sexual offences with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Criminal damage and arson ( -50.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 1 (≈ 5.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-50.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-58.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Cedarwood Glade (TS8 9DJ),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Arrandale, where police recorded 17 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Arkendale (11 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
